Photo Are enrolled in the California Alternating Rates for Energy (TREATMENT) or Family Electric Rate Assistance (FERA) program. Have been an SCE client for at the very least six months. Have a past-due costs totaling up to greater than $500 (several of which have actually been overdue for even more than 90 days). Have made a minimum of one on-time payment in the previous 24 months.
Consumers who sign up in the AMP program are not eligible for installment plans. Net Energy Metering (NEM), Direct Accessibility (DA), and master metered customers are not currently qualified. For clients intending on relocating within the next 60 days, please use to AMP after you have actually developed solution at your new move-in address.
The catch is that not-for-profit Credit history Card Financial debt Forgiveness isn't for everyone. To qualify, you should not have actually made a repayment on your bank card account, or accounts, for 120-180 days. Additionally, not all lenders get involved, and it's just supplied by a few nonprofit credit history therapy firms. InCharge Financial debt Solutions is among them.

The Bank Card Forgiveness Program is for individuals who are until now behind on charge card settlements that they are in serious monetary difficulty, potentially facing bankruptcy, and do not have the earnings to catch up."The program is particularly created to help clients whose accounts have been billed off," Mostafa Imakhchachen, client care expert at InCharge Financial obligation Solutions, stated.
Creditors who participate have concurred with the nonprofit credit score therapy firm to accept 50%-60% of what is owed in repaired month-to-month repayments over 36 months. The fixed repayments indicate you understand exactly just how much you'll pay over the settlement duration. No passion is charged on the equilibriums during the benefit period, so the repayments and amount owed don't transform.

The therapist will certainly assess your finances with you to figure out if the program is the right option. The testimonial will consist of a look at your month-to-month revenue and costs. The company will certainly draw a credit rating report to recognize what you owe and the degree of your hardship. If the forgiveness program is the most effective service, the counselor will certainly send you a contract that information the plan, consisting of the quantity of the regular monthly payment.
Once everybody agrees, you start making regular monthly repayments on a 36-month plan. When it's over, the agreed-to quantity is gotten rid of. There's no penalty for paying off the balance early, yet no extensions are allowed. If you miss out on a settlement, the arrangement is nullified, and you must exit the program. Nonprofit Charge Card Financial obligation Mercy and for-profit financial debt settlement are similar in that they both supply a means to clear up credit rating card financial obligation by paying less than what is owed.
Charge card forgiveness is designed to set you back the consumer much less, repay the debt quicker, and have fewer downsides than its for-profit equivalent. Some essential areas of difference in between Bank card Financial debt Forgiveness and for-profit debt negotiation are: Charge card Financial obligation Mercy programs have partnerships with lenders that have consented to participate.
Once they do, the payoff period starts promptly. For-profit financial obligation settlement programs work out with each financial institution, usually over a 2-3-year period, while interest, charges and calls from financial debt collection agencies continue. This indicates a larger hit on your debt record and credit report, and a raising equilibrium up until arrangement is completed.
Credit Scores Card Financial debt Mercy clients make 36 equal regular monthly payments to eliminate their financial obligation. For-profit financial debt settlement customers pay right into an escrow account over a negotiation duration towards a lump sum that will be paid to financial institutions.
